Directions:

  1. Spray a large skillet with non-stick spray and place over medium heat.
  2. Add the onions, garlic, and a little broth and cook until softened, 6 to 8 minutes, stirring often to cook evenly.
  3. Spray the slow cooker, at least 5 quarts in size, with non-stick spray.
  4. Put the all of the ingredients into the slow cooker, including the onions, garlic, and broth from the skillet.
  5. Add enough broth to just cover everything.
  6. Cover and cook on HIGH for 4 hours.
  7. Blend the final product. (I use a hand blender.).
  8. Ladle the hot soup into bowls and enjoy.
